As we touched on, Rolex watches are made with the best materials on the market. With stainless steel, gold, and platinum pieces, Rolex watches have high-quality materials that are not likely to be found on fake watches. Additionally, knowing which material a specific Rolex model is made of can also help spot a fake. For instance, certain models like the Milgauss, Explorer II, and Deepsea have only been produced in stainless steel, and any made with other materials are replicas. Similarly, watches from Rolex’s Day-Date collection are exclusively made with precious metals, specifically gold or platinum, and any made with other materials are likely to be fake. All Rolex watches are crafted in the company’s own facilities in Switzerland, from initial design to final assembly. Rolex has multiple production sites, including its headquarters in Geneva; the main manufacturing facility, located in nearby Plan-les-Ouates; and production outposts in Chêne-Bourg and Bienne. The winding crown on a Rolex is always on the right side of the case for easy access — assuming it’s worn on the left wrist. The one exception is the left-handed GMT-Master II, which was introduced in 2022 to accommodate left-handed wearers.

Although some obscure gold-plated vintage Rolex models (like 3386, 1550, 1024 etc.) do exist, Rolex has never used gold plating on any sports model, Day-Date, or Datejust. Rehaut engravings on current Rolexes have a clean, sandblasted appearance. Some earlier engraved rehauts were hollow block letters, but they look very clean. Real Rolex rehauts aren’t always aligned perfectly, but they should be close. The minute lines might not exactly bisect each letter, but if any minute line is so far off that it’s not even touching a letter, that’s a pretty conclusive sign of a fake. Furthermore, Rolex also uses a patented rose gold alloy with some platinum mixed in that the brand calls Everose. For Rolex platinum timepieces, only 950 platinum will do, which is comprised of 95% pure platinum. The term Rolesor refers to the use of both gold and stainless steel on a particular model. On the other hand, Rolesium refers to the use of both platinum and stainless steel on a specific watch.

A Rolex’s serial number is found where the bracelet meets the case of the watch, below 6 o’clock. The model number on the other hand, is found between the lugs above 12 o’clock, accompanied by the text “ORIG ROLEX DESIGN” right above the number. The Triplock crown, which bears the Rolex crown logo above three dots, was first used on the Rolex Sea-Dweller, in 1970.
